LOG: [analyzer] Fix taint rule of fgets and setproctitle_init

There was a typo in the rule.
`{{0}, ReturnValueIndex}` meant that the discrete index is `0` and the
variadic index is `-1`.
What we wanted instead is that both `0` and `-1` are in the discrete index
list.

Instead of this, we wanted to express that both `0` and the
`ReturnValueIndex` is in the discrete arg list.

The manual inspection revealed that `setproctitle_init` also suffered a
probably incomplete propagation rule.
